Learn more: aus.com/earnmore. As a Front Desk Security Professional with Allied Universal at a leading financial institution, you will be the first point of contact for visitors and employees. Your primary responsibilities include managing access control, assisting guests, and providing exceptional customer service while helping to deter security-related incidents. You will utilize technology to support daily operations and contribute to a welcoming and secure environment, all while embodying our values of teamwork, integrity, and putting people first.

Responsibilities

  • Greet visitors and employees in a professional manner while monitoring access to the location.
  • Verify identification and credentials for individuals entering the premises, following site-specific policies and procedures.
  • Assist with visitor registration and direct guests to appropriate areas as needed.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, following established protocols.
  • Maintain detailed and accurate records of daily activities, incidents, and/or unusual occurrences.
  • Monitor security-related systems such as cameras, alarms, and access control devices from the front desk.
  • Provide customer service by answering questions and addressing concerns from visitors, employees, and/or clients.
  • Support Allied Universal and client staff during emergency response activities as directed.
